GridLoom Crossword Generator — Regeneration Runbook (excerpt). Before regenerating the weekly puzzle set, confirm the wordlist snapshot in Lexivault matches the approved revision; contractors must never edit the snapshot directly. Run the fill pass twice and compare grid checksums — mismatches mean a nondeterministic seed leaked in. If checksums agree, record the build token shown below in your handoff note.

session token of taweg-kagup = htk6_48a1bb

## Building Access During Intern Arrival Week

Contractors visiting the Larkspur Hall site should expect heavier lobby traffic while the Dunmore Analytics intern cohort is onboarded. Use the east entrance rather than the main doors, and allow extra time at the turnstiles. The east entrance keypad will be active all week, and the current code is given below.

door code, yagap-bahof: bdg-O-05

# Break-Glass: Catalog Cache Invalidation

Scope: the Pinrow product catalog at Veldstone Retail. If stale prices persist after a purge and the Hollowmere invalidation queue is wedged, use break-glass to flush the edge tier directly. Contractors: get verbal sign-off from the catalog lead first. Steps: open the Hollowmere admin shell, select emergency-flush, confirm the tenant, and run it once — repeated flushes thrash the origin. Access is logged and expires after 20 minutes. Unseal the admin shell with the passphrase below.

recovery phrase for kahop-tajog: istix-casvan

# Who to Contact: Renderstack Transcoding Farm

Renderstack handles all video transcoding for Oakfield products. Stuck jobs: check the farm dashboard before escalating. Failed jobs with codec errors: resubmit once, then file a ticket. Capacity complaints go to the media infra rotation, not individual engineers. Never restart worker nodes yourself. Billing or quota questions belong with the accounts team. For anything not covered above, reach the media infra rotation at their shared address.

escalation mailbox, bafog-fafog: ulador@paliqlabs.internal

Alert: SweeperStall — the Tidewell orphaned-resource sweeper has not completed a full pass in over six hours. Unreclaimed volumes and dangling snapshots will accumulate, raising storage costs and quota pressure. Check the sweeper's lease lock first; a stuck lease is the most common cause. The runbook with recovery steps is here.

runbook for badug-kadup: https://confluence.zemvarlabs.internal/projects/browse/display/projects/bd1b